Fastboot刷机命令是Android设备开发者和高级用户常用的工具,主要用于设备的底层操作,如刷入系统镜像、解锁Bootloader、分区操作等,Fastboot是Android系统启动模式之一,通过USB连接电脑,利用命令行工具与设备进行交互,适用于设备无法正常进入系统时的维护和升级,以下将详细介绍常用的Fastboot命令及其使用场景。

确保设备已解锁Bootloader,并进入Fastboot模式,通常通过关机状态下按特定组合键(如音量下+电源键)进入,电脑端需安装Android SDK Platform Tools,包含Fastboot工具,常用命令包括:
fastboot devices:检测设备是否连接成功,若显示设备序列号,表示连接正常;若无输出,需检查驱动或连接线。
fastboot oem unlock:解锁Bootloader,解锁后设备数据会被清除,需提前备份,部分设备需在开发者选项中启用OEM解锁选项。
fastboot flash boot boot.img:刷入Boot分区镜像,boot.img是内核和ramdisk的合集,用于系统启动,需确保镜像文件路径正确。
(图片来源网络,侵删)fastboot flash system system.img:刷入系统分区镜像,完整系统刷入耗时较长,需保证镜像文件完整性。
fastboot flash recovery recovery.img:刷入自定义 recovery(如TWRP),recovery用于系统备份、刷机等高级操作。
fastboot flash-all:一键刷入完整系统包,需将所有镜像文件(boot、system、vendor等)放入指定目录,自动按顺序刷入。
fastboot erase partition_name:擦除指定分区数据,例如
fastboot cache清除缓存分区,fastboot data清除用户数据。
(图片来源网络,侵删)fastboot format partition_name:格式化指定分区,操作不可逆,会彻底清除分区数据,需谨慎使用。
fastboot reboot:重启设备,退出Fastboot模式,正常启动系统。
fastboot getvar all:获取设备所有变量信息,包括Bootloader版本、锁定状态等,便于调试。
fastboot oem lock:重新锁定Bootloader,解锁后可锁定,但部分设备锁定后无法降级系统版本。
fastboot flash vendor vendor.img:刷入vendor分区镜像,vendor分区包含硬件驱动和厂商特定代码,对系统兼容性至关重要。
fastboot sideload:通过 recovery 刷入ZIP包,需在recovery中选择“Apply update from ADB”,然后执行
fastboot sideload update.zip。fastboot -i 0x0fce devices:指定厂商ID识别设备,多设备连接时使用,避免混淆。
fastboot partition:all flash all_partitions.zip:刷入分区表,适用于修复分区错误或更换分区布局,操作风险高,需谨慎。
使用命令时需注意:镜像文件需与设备型号匹配,错误刷入可能导致设备变砖;确保电量充足(50%以上),避免断电;部分命令会清除数据,提前备份重要文件,对于普通用户,建议使用官方提供的刷机工具,降低风险。
相关问答FAQs
Q1: 解锁Bootloader后数据一定会丢失吗?
A1: 是的,解锁Bootloader会清除设备所有数据,包括内部存储、应用和设置,解锁前需通过云备份或本地备份(如ADB备份)保存重要数据,部分设备支持解锁后保留数据,但需确认厂商政策,通常不建议依赖此功能。
Q2: Fastboot刷机失败怎么办?
A2: 首先检查连接线是否松动,驱动是否正确安装;确认镜像文件与设备型号匹配,无损坏;尝试重新解锁Bootloader或进入Fastboot模式;若仍失败,可尝试官方刷机工具或联系厂商售后,避免反复尝试,以免加剧硬件损坏。
文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/480415.html<
